It also has been hypothesized that the timing of exposure to artificial nipples is important in
mediating effects on breastfeeding.2 — 4,15 Thus, according to this hypothesis, mother — infant dyads who begin pacifier use before breastfeeding is well established incur a higher risk for problems than do couplets who have successfully established breastfeeding before pacifier introduction.
A randomized clinical trial of restricted supplemental formula and pacifier use during the first 5 days of life demonstrated no
significant effects on breastfeeding.13 Longer periods of avoidance, however, have not been assessed.
